文章发布中的WordPress tinymce问题

时间:2012-12-01 07:17:04

标签: php wordpress tinymce

在一个特定用户的WordPress文章发布中发现了一个奇怪的问题。

  1. 用户在tinymce HTML模式中添加文章
  2. 再次尝试在tinymce Visual模式中添加新帖子。实际上没有发布,只是将tinymce选中的标签从HTML切换到Visual
  3. 用户试图在setp 1中打开以HTML模式保存的帖子,它显示了在Tabs中激活的可视模式,但加载的图标来自HTML模式。 tinymce内容现在无法查看,内容已存在但无法查看,如果我按CTRL + A,我可以查看内容,并且还会阻止其他功能,如编辑草稿,注销等。
  4. 现在,如果用户再次尝试添加新帖子,并从tinymce选项卡中选择HTML并退出页面
  5. 他试图编辑在setp 1中添加的帖子,现在它正确显示。
  6. 内容没有问题,因为我尝试在新帖子中复制并粘贴此内容并且工作正常。

    所有用户都没有这样做。另外还有1点在Visual模式下加载的图标比管理员帐户中的图标少得多。

3 个答案:

答案 0 :(得分:2)

试试这个插件 - http://wordpress.ckeditor.com/。它取代了tinymce,许多人发现它更加用户友好'。它有一个来源'模式似乎比tinymce的HTML模式更好。

答案 1 :(得分:0)

你应该使用firebug来调试你的js-code。

可能TinyMCE无法正确初始化,因为之前发生了JS错误(在你的js代码或wordpress插件中,即安全的WordPress)。

选中此项可能会有所帮助:http://wordpress.org/support/topic/uncaught-referenceerror-switcheditors-is-not-defined

答案 2 :(得分:0)

您可以尝试的第一件事是转到用户>您的个人资料,在编辑时禁用可视编辑器,保存设置,然后取消选中该框并再次保存设置。

之后,检查tinyMCE是否正常运行,否则,尝试逐个禁用插件,找出导致jQuery冲突的插件。